Ingredients:

The secret behind the ability of Chyawanprabha to strengthen the immune system can be traced back to its ingredients and composition. The ingredients present in  Patanjali Chyawanprabha are:

Gooseberry or Amla:

Amla

The scientific name of Amla is Emblica Officinalis, and it is used in this product because it has great anti-oxidant, anti-aging, and anti-cancer properties.

Ghee:

Ghee

Ghrita or Ghee is a well-known household ingredient in India. It is popular for having nourishing properties that help in the improvement of skin, strength, luster, voice, immunity, memory, digestion and intelligence, etc.

Bamboo:

Bamboo

Patanjali Chyawanprabha contains Bamboo or Vamsha, which is its Ayurvedic name. It is a powerful ingredient that has mucolytic and anti-inflammatory, and antipyretic properties. It has also been used in the treatment of several skin infections and reproductive diseases.

Malabar Nut:

Malabar Nut

Also known as Adusa and Adhatoda, the ingredient has found its way into the treatment of complex respiratory conditions such as asthma, bronchitis, and cough. It is touted as one of the most powerful herbs in Ayurveda.

Bruhati:

Bruhati

Scientific name of Bruhtati is Solanum indicum, and this herb is also known for the treatment of an array of respiratory disorders.

Kantkari:

Kantkari

The scientific name for this medicinal plant is Solanum surattense and it possesses healing powers for conditions like asthma, cold, cough, flu, and fever.

Gokhru:

Gokhru

Popularly known as Tribulus, is a good agent for providing strength and revitalizing the body. It also boosts immunity and acts as a natural aphrodisiac.

Agnimanth:

Agnimanth

Another popular Ayurvedic herb ,is Agnimanth. It garners properties like an antioxidant that make it a constituent in the Dasha moola family of herbs.

Sonapatha:

Sonapatha

It is one of the most essential herbs in Chyawanprabha as it is considered vital for the treatment of several infections, cough, fever, and diarrhea. The herb has antitumor and cytotoxic properties that prevent the metastasis of cancerous cells.

Gambhari:

Gambhari

The fruit of this herb is a potent brain tonic and also functions as an anti-inflammatory agent.

Mudgaparni:

Mudgaparni

This medicinal plant has a powerful effect on the male reproductive system and has been used for the treatment of conditions like oligospermia.

Draksha:

Draksha

This herb provides the property of nourishment to Chyawanprabha and contributes to rejuvenating the organ and organ systems.

 

Giloy:

Giloy

It has immunomodulating properties that function to improve the immunity of an individual.

Nagarmotha:

Nagarmotha

This herb is associated with lactation and relief from thirst, pain, or fever.

Lavanga:

Lavanga

Commonly known as Clove, this herb is important for treating respiratory diseases and has been used in several households.

Cinnamon:

Cinnamon

A common spice used in India, Dalchini is popular for its ability to improve digestive efficiency and bowel movement.

These are only a few of the many ingredients present in Chyawanprabha by Patanjali. It is jam-packed with resourceful and healing medicinal herbs that improve the body's function and helps in boosting its immunity.

    How to Use:

    As per the instructions mentioned in the Patanjali Chyawanprabha guide, it should be consumed in the following ways.

    • Take 1-2 tablespoons a day.

    • Have it at least 2 times a day.

    • Have it with lukewarm milk.

    Tips:

    Patanjali Chyawanprabha should be kept fresh and edible in the following ways.

    • Store at a cool and dry place.

    • Keep away from direct sunlight.
